Coronavirus False information about interest rate restrictions is being disseminated on behalf of the City of Espoo

Messages have been sent at least to the organizers of winter sports competitions.

Espoon The Gmail address created in the name of the city has sent incorrect information about the interest rate restrictions to event organizers. Messages have been sent at least to the organizers of winter sports competitions.

There are several incorrect statements in the messages. At least some of the messages have been signed in the name of the “Espoo Coronavirus Prevention Team”.

Espoo announced the messages on Thursday.

If The City of Espoo will provide instructions by e-mail, the message will always come from an address ending in espoo.fi or opetus.espoo.fi, the city press release states.

Up-to-date information on the interest rate restrictions and recommendations in force in Espoo can be found on the city’s website.

“I urge people to be careful. It is very unfortunate that such disinformation, i.e. deliberately misleading information, is being disseminated again. If you are not quite sure that this is an official instruction from the authorities, at least do not share it further, ”instructs the City of Espoo Security Manager. Petri Häkkinen in the bulletin.

If If you want to report suspicious messages, please contact the City of Espoo electronic feedback channel through.

Select “Other and general feedback” as the subject of your feedback and then “Security in the City of Espoo”, and the message will be directed directly to the security experts.
